Brain tonic in the form of green tea!

According to a new Japanese study appearing in the current issue of the American Journal of Clinical Nutrition, drinking green tea daily may help reduce risk of dementia,.// The amount of green tea consumed was inversely related with the risk of having cognitive impairment in the aging process...

Alcohol is no tonic for sleep

Although alcohol can initially help someone fall asleep, it can also disrupt sleep in the latter part of the night, reports the journal Alcoholism: Clinical & Experimental Research.// "Three or more drinks will cause the average person to fall asleep sooner than usual," says researcher Shawn C...

Phasic firing of dopamine neurons is key to brain's prediction of rewards

...nd amphetamine," said Paladini, who is also a member of UTSA's Neurosciences Institute. Midbrain dopamine neurons fire in two characteristic modes, tonic and phasic, which are thought to modulate distinct aspects of behavior.
